Here are the steps with pictures. This works with many different effects as well! I'm using it to zoom smoothly over many different videos.
1. Make a new adjustment layer
a. Right click in your project tab
b. New item -> Adjustment layer...
2. Place the adjustment layer above the pictures/video in the timeline
3. Add an effect called "Transform" to the adjustment layer
4. Apply the key framing to the adjustment layer
